Is hard boiled egg hyphenated?
The Oxford English Dictionary points out that hard, before a participial adjective, is ‘always hyphenated’ when the compound is used attributively, as in ‘hard-boiled egg’.

What is a 4 minute egg?
4 minutes – The white is fully set, but the yolk is thick and runny. 6 minutes – The white is fully set, and the yolk is mostly set, but still a little runny in the middle. 8 minutes – The white is fully set, and the yolk is set, but tender. 10 minutes – The white is fully set, and the yolk is fully set.
What is considered a full boil?
A full boil, rolling boil or real boil occurs at 212 F. A full boil happens when all the water in the pot gets involved in fast-moving rolling waves of bubbles. The water bubbles enthusiastically and gives off steam.
What is the difference between a boil and a rolling boil?
A boil occurs when large bubbles come from the bottom of the pot and quickly rise to the surface, producing constant steam. A rolling boil is used for cooking pasta and blanching green vegetables to help them maintain their color.
